Why is it important to have the sympathetic and parasympathetic nervous systems, especially since their action?

Because they are responsible for automatic functions in your body, like heart and ventilation rate, urges to go to the bathroom, perspiration and production of saliva, contraction and dilation of pupils, etc.

Usually they are antagonistic (Sympathetic operates more under stress while Parasympathetic doesn't) but it's not ALWAYS the case.

Also of note, many of the instances in which they are antagonistic, they will not operate by giving opposed stimuli to the same effector but rather both might stimulate opposing effectors, etc.
